3.6.1 Integrated totals object grouping
The existing IT objects can individually be configured to belong to any IT object
group 1…4. When an IT master command is performed, it can be directed only to a
specific IT object group or to all IT object groups. There are two commands related
to counter groups.
Freeze counters, C_CI_NA_1 (FRZ) - Freezes/latches momentary counter values
simultaneously and saves them as internal frozen counter values
Read frozen counters, C_RD_NA_1 (RQT) - Requests the internally saved frozen
counter values
3.6.2 Freeze operation alternatives
A freeze operation can be issued either by a master command C_CI_NA_1
(QCC=FRZ), or by an internal freeze pulse applied to the I5CLPRT function block’s
input IT_FRZ.
The new frozen counter values can be either sent spontaneously to the master, or
they can remain internally in the protocol stack for later reading by the master using
command C_CI_NA_1 (QCC=RQT).
A new freeze operation overwrites the previously stored frozen counter values.
The freeze command operation C_CI_NA_1 (QCC=FRZ) can be defined to be “freeze
only” or “freeze and reset”. In the latter case, the protocol tries to reset the counters
after the value freezing. Some IEC 61850 counters cannot be physically reset. The
counters in this device are globally reset for all possible readers, for example, for
other protocols and for reading via HMI.
Two setting parameters define how the freeze operation is handled.
Freeze mode
defines if the I5CLPRT function block's IT_FRZ input is used, and if
the externally triggered operation is “freeze only” or “freeze and reset”.
Counter reporting
defines what happens after the counters have been frozen.
Frozen counters can be configured for spontaneous reporting with this setting.
The IEC 60870-5 standard terms “memorize” and “memorize and
increment” correspond to “freeze” and “freeze and reset”.
3.7 Secure communication
3.7.1 Secure authentication setup
The relay supports secure authentication based on the IEC 60870-5-7 standard
with symmetric keys. The functionality follows the IEC 62351-5 security standard's
authentication specification, but the “User Status Change” and “Update Key
functionality is not supported. The relay supports only one predefined user.
Secure application authentication can be used with or without TLS. The secure
authentication is enabled in the relay by the setting parameter
Protocol Sec Mode
under Configuration> Communication> Protocols> Secure IEC104 (n)> General.
